Table 2.

Overlap between drug candidates identified by the CANDO platform and those identified by Kouznetsova et al. [27].

Compound(s) Interaction Score Consensus Score Approved Indication Mode of Action
Niclosamide * 1.897 3 helminthic infestation inhibits parasite metabolism
Sertraline * 1.897 1 depression, anxiety selective serotonin receptor inhibitor
Clomifene * 1.897 1 anovulation, oligoovulation selective estrogen receptor modulator
Alverine 1.897 1 gastrointestinal muscle spasms parasympathetic nervous system modulator
Aprindine 1.897 1 cardiac arrhythmia sodium channel inhibitor
Mebendazole * 1.897 1 helminthic infestation tubulin destabilizer
Salmeterol 1.890 2 asthma beta 2 adrenergic receptor agonist
Topotecan 1.823 1 ovarian and lung cancers DNA topoisomerase I inhibitor
Deslanoside * 1.377 10 cardiac arrhythmia sodium-potassium channel blocker
Propafenone 1.298 10 cardiac arrhythmia sodium channel blocker
Digoxin * 1.067 1 cardiac arrhythmia sodium-potassium channel blocker
Proglumetacin 1.058 1 non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ug cyclooxygenase-1 inhibitor
Posaconazole 1.023 3 fungal infection (aspergillus and candida) membrane bound enzyme inhibitor
Raloxifene * 0.843 2 osteoporosis and breast cancer prevention selective estrogen receptor modulator
Clarithromycin 0.741 2 bacterial infections protein synthesis inhibitor
Clemastine * 0.741 1 allergies H1 histamine receptor inhibitor
Colchicine 0.741 1 gout, pericarditis microtubule inhibitor
Tamoxifen * 0.741 1 estrogen receptor positive breast cancer Selective estrogen receptor modulator
Thiothixene 0.741 1 psychotic disorders, e.g., schizophrenia dopamine antagonist
Daunorubicin 0.714 1 hematologic dyscrasia (acute lymphocytic leukemia, acute myeloid leukemia) DNA topoisomerase II inhibitor
Dronedarone 0.722 1 cardiac arrhythmia potassium channel blocker
Vincristine 0.707 1 hematologic dyscrasia (acute lymphocytic leukemia, acute myeloid leukemia) microtubule inhibitor

* Drugs also identified by Johansen et al. [28].
